Odessa Brown Children’s Clinic is a cherished part of the central Seattle community.

Odessa Brown Children's Clinic is an inner-city, satellite clinic of Seattle Children's Hospital and Regional Medical Center providing medical and dental care to children and adolescents.

Part of the Central Area Health Care Center, Odessa Brown Children’s Clinic serves predominantly low-income, multiethnic families in the surrounding community. Pediatricians at the Odessa Brown Children’s Clinic serve as continuity clinic attendings.

A Sickle Cell Clinic staffed by hematologists from Children's Hospital is held twice monthly at the clinic. Also, opportunities exist to provide back-up medical consultation for the Teen Health Center at Garfield High School.

Residents have had an established role at the Odessa Brown Children’s Clinic since it opened its doors in 1970. The clinic is a cherished part of the central Seattle community and has become a destination clinic for many families outside of Seattle seeking the level of comprehensive pediatric care they can’t get anywhere else.
